What Is Rhodiola Rosea and How Does It Function?
Rhodiola Rosea is a wild perennial flowering plant species. It thrives in high altitude cold regions across Europe and Asia. Botanists classify this high altitude herb as a natural adaptogen. Adaptogenic plants strengthen your physical body against diverse physical and mental stressors. Herbalists historically used the rhizome roots to combat harsh arctic climate fatigue.
Active chemical compounds inside the root drive its therapeutic performance benefits. Scientists identify rosavins and salidrosides as the primary active ingredients. Rosavins exist exclusively within the authentic Rhodiola Rosea plant species. These bioactive molecules interact directly with your central nervous system. They influence key neurotransmitter activity and regulate overall cellular energy production.
Hard physical exercise triggers intense biological stress within your muscle tissue. Rhodiola Rosea stabilizes your internal biochemistry during strenuous physical exertion. It prevents excessive adrenal fatigue and regulates heart rate responses under pressure. This natural action allows dedicated athletes to maintain high training intensities for longer periods.
The Biological Mechanism Behind Fatigue Resistance
Physical fatigue limits your total athletic output during intense workout sessions. Fatigue stems from central nervous system exhaustion and cellular fuel depletion. Rhodiola Rosea targets both biological pathways simultaneously to sustain athletic performance.
The herb inhibits monoamine oxidase enzymes within your brain tissue. This enzyme blockade increases circulating levels of serotonin and dopamine naturally. Dopamine enhances fine motor control, mental focus, and workout motivation. Higher serotonin levels improve overall mood stability and pain tolerance during grueling lifting sets.
At the cellular level, the extract stimulates adenosine triphosphate synthesis. Adenosine triphosphate serves as the primary energy currency for contracting skeletal muscles. The herb accelerates cellular energy production inside active muscle mitochondria. Rapid fuel production protects active muscle cells against metabolic exhaustion during heavy exercise.

Supporting Cortisol Balance and Stress Management
Cortisol acts as your body’s primary catabolic stress hormone. Your adrenal glands secrete extra cortisol during periods of intense physical strain. While acute cortisol release mobilizes energy, chronic elevation destroys lean muscle tissue.
Catabolic stress hormones break down muscle proteins into simple amino acids. Excess cortisol also suppresses natural anabolic hormone production like testosterone. Rhodiola Rosea modulates your adrenal response to prevent excessive cortisol spikes. Controlling cortisol release protects your hard earned muscle mass from catabolic breakdown.
Stable stress hormone levels also promote rapid recovery after exhaustive workout sessions. Your body shifts out of sympathetic fight or flight mode quickly. Fast parasympathetic activation helps your system rest, digest, and rebuild lean muscle mass.

Optimal Dosage Guidelines for Athletes
Consuming the correct clinical dosage guarantees real performance improvements. Taking too little product will yield zero noticeable performance benefits in the gym.
| Supplementation Form | Clinical Dosage Recommendation | Preferred Intake Timing |
| Standardized Extract (3% Rosavins) | 200 mg to 600 mg daily | Single dose pre workout on empty stomach |
| Raw Plant Powder | 1,500 mg to 3,000 mg daily | Divided doses taken with whole meals |
| Liquid Tincture Extract | 2 ml to 5 ml daily | Mixed with water 30 minutes pre workout |
Select extract products standardized to contain three percent rosavins and one percent salidrosides. This specific chemical ratio mirrors the exact proportions used in successful clinical trials. Take your daily dose approximately 45 minutes before starting your exercise session. Consuming the extract on an empty stomach maximizes intestinal compound absorption.

Potential Side Effects and Safety Precautions
Rhodiola Rosea exhibits an excellent safety profile for most healthy individuals. However, minor side effects can occur if you consume excessive doses.
- High dosages may cause mild jitteriness, restlessness, or agitation.
- Taking the supplement late in the day can cause unwanted insomnia.
- Dry mouth and temporary dizziness occur occasionally in sensitive users.
- High intake on an empty stomach can trigger mild digestive upset.
- Overuse without breaks can reduce effectiveness over long periods.
If you experience unwanted restlessness, reduce your total daily dosage immediately. Never exceed the recommended upper limit of 600 milligrams per day. Quality supplement manufacturing prevents product contamination and ensures accurate ingredient dosing.
Who Should Avoid Using Rhodiola Rosea?
Certain groups of people should exercise caution or avoid taking adaptogenic extracts completely. Always prioritize long term health over short term physical gains.
Groups Who Must Avoid Usage
- People diagnosed with bipolar disorder due to high stimulation risks.
- Individuals taking prescription antidepressant medications or MAO inhibitors.
- Pregnant or nursing women due to limited clinical safety data.
- People taking prescription blood thinners or blood pressure drugs.
- Children and teenagers under eighteen years of age.
The extract mildly stimulates central nervous system pathways and alters monoamine activity. This action can interact negatively with mood stabilizing prescription medications. Always consult a qualified healthcare provider before adding new active supplements to your routine.
